This issue was not resolved in load 2019-05-24 17:41:41 .
PTP enabled install with below configuration is showing incorrect alarm in a lab have LAG configuration. Also worker nodes are not enabled with PTP.
system ptp-show +--------------+--------------------------------------+ | Property | Value | +--------------+--------------------------------------+ | uuid | 20dfb6de-9768-43e5-8e5b-8cd69a750382 | | enabled | True | | mode | hardware | | transport | l2 | | mechanism | e2e | | isystem_uuid | 1b1c2588-d22a-4cce-9863-14803019a485 | | created_at | 2019-05-27T15:19:57.833466+00:00 | | updated_at | 2019-05-27T15:28:28.867380+00:00 | +--------------+--------------------------------------+ fm alarm-list +----------+-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------+--------------------------------------+----------+------------------+ | Alarm ID | Reason Text | Entity ID | Severity | Time Stamp | +----------+-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------+--------------------------------------+----------+------------------+ | 100.119 | Provisioned Precision Time Protocol (PTP) 'hardware' time stamping mode seems to be | host=compute-1.ptp | major | 2019-05-27T16:57 | | | unsupported by this host | | | :30.836681 | | | | | | | | 100.119 | Provisioned Precision Time Protocol (PTP) 'hardware' time stamping mode seems to be | host=compute-0.ptp | major | 2019-05-27T16:49 | | | unsupported by this host | | | :02.174386 | | | | | | | | 800.001 | Storage Alarm Condition: HEALTH_WARN [PGs are degraded/stuck or undersized]. Please check | cluster=0be8842d-826a-4b2c- | warning | 2019-05-27T16:20 | | | 'ceph -s' for more details. | 89b2-53a54c1204f0 | | :34.839210 | | | | | | | +----------+-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------+--------------------------------------+--------- compute-1:~$ sudo pmc -u -b 0 'GET PORT_DATA_SET' Password: sending: GET PORT_DATA_SET pmc[3832.254]: uds: sendto failed: No such file or directory
